Web18 mrt. 2016 · In general, Arizona allows multiple individuals to hold title in one of three ways: tenancy in common, joint tenancy, and community property (§ 33-431). According to § 33-431(A), Arizona presumes tenancy in common for two or more owners (who are not married to each other) unless otherwise specified in the deed.
